[HACKERS] Unicode escapes in literals

2008-10-23 Thread Peter Eisentraut
I would like to add an escape mechanism to PostgreSQL for entering 
arbitrary Unicode characters into string literals.  We currently only 
have the option of entering the character directly via the keyboard or 
cut-and-paste, which is difficult for a number of reasons, such as when 
the font doesn't have the character, and entering the UTF8-encoded bytes 
using the E'...' strings, which is hardly usable.


SQL has the following escape syntax for it:

   U'special character: \' [ UESCAPE '\' ]

where  is the hexadecimal Unicode codepoint.  So this is pretty much 
just another variant on what the E'...' syntax does.


The trick is that since we have user-definable encoding conversion 
routines, we can't convert the Unicode codepoint to the server encoding 
in the scanner stage.  I imagine there are two ways to address this:


1. Only support this syntax when the server encoding is UTF8.  This 
would probably cover most use cases anyway.  We could have limited 
support for characters in the ASCII range for all server encodings.


2. Convert this syntax to a function call.  But that would then create a 
lot of inconsistencies, such as needing functional indexes for matches 
against what should really be a literal.


I'd be happy to start with UTF8 support only.  Other ideas?

[HACKERS] A small performance bug in BTree Infrastructure

2008-10-23 Thread Gokulakannan Somasundaram
Hi All,
   BTree Insert requires a data-structure called BTStack to report the
page splits that have happened in the leaf pages to non-leaf pages upwards.
It basically goes back and updates those non-leaf pages. But this will never
happen in a search operation. You never need to climb upwards for a  Select
statement. Actually we can clearly see that in the _bt_first function, as
soon as we complete calling _bt_search, we call _bt_freestack to free it. So
unnecessarily a BTStack structure is getting formed and deleted.
   Inside _bt_search function, if we just add a if condition to check
whether access is for BT_READ, then we can avoid the creation of stack and
also remove the _bt_freestack  in the _bt_first function. I just implemented
the change and tested it and i am not seeing any performance difference(as
expected).

Still i thought of reporting it, so that whoever is working on it,
can incorporate this change also.

Some time ago, we arranged for shared buffers to be aligned on *more*
than maxalign boundaries (cf BUFFERALIGN) because on at least some
platforms this makes a very significant difference in the speed of
copying to/from kernel space.  If you are going to double-buffer it
is going to be important to have the intermediate buffer just as well
aligned.  A local char array won't be acceptable, and even for a
palloc'd one you'll need to take some extra steps (like wasting
ALIGNOF_BUFFER extra bytes so you can align the pointer palloc gives).

[HACKERS] Reducing the memory footprint of large sets of pending triggers

2008-10-23 Thread Tom Lane
We've occasionally talked about allowing pending-trigger-event lists to
spill to disk when there get to be so many events that it's a memory
problem.  I'm not especially interested in doing that right now, but
I noticed recently that we could alleviate the problem a lot by adopting
a more compact representation.

Currently, each event is a separately palloc'd instance of struct
AfterTriggerEventData.  On a 32-bit machine that struct takes 32 bytes,
plus 8 bytes palloc overhead = 40 bytes.  On a 64-bit machine the struct
takes 36 bytes, but palloc rounds that up to 64 bytes, plus there's 16
bytes palloc overhead = 80 bytes :-(.

I see several things we could do here:

* Allocate the event structs in reasonably-large arrays instead of
separate palloc chunks.  This would require some data copying where we
now get away with pointer-swinging --- but on the other hand per-event
palloc'ing isn't exactly free either, so I suspect that this would net
out to a wash if not an actual speedup.

* Don't store the ate_tgoid and ate_relid fields in each individual
event struct.  Instead keep a separate array with one instance of these
values for each distinct trigger that's been fired in the current
transaction (in most cases this list should be pretty short, even if
there are many events).  We can commandeer the high order bits of
ate_event to store an index into that array.  Currently only 8 bits
of ate_event are actually used, so we'd have room for 16 million
distinct triggers fired in a transaction.  Even if we need a few more
ate_event flag bits later, I don't see a problem there.

* Don't store two ItemPointers in insert or delete events.  This would
make the array element stride variable, but since we don't need random
access into the arrays AFAICS, that doesn't seem to be a problem.

In combination these changes would get us down to 16 bytes per
insert/delete and 20 per update event, which represents a factor of 2
or 2.5 savings on a 32-bit machine and a factor of 4 or 5 on a 64-bit
machine.  Seems worth doing to me, especially since it looks like
only about a 1-day project touching only a single source file.

It might be possible to go further and move the event status bits and
firing_id into the separate array, which would save a further four bytes
per event in the typical situation that a lot of events of the same
trigger are queued by a single command.  I think I'd want to tackle that
as a follow-on patch though, because it would be a change in the data
structure semantics not just rearranging the representation a tad.

Comments, better ideas?

Well it's just as portable, they're both specified by posix. Actually  
async I/o is in the real-time extensions so one could argue it's less  
portable. Also before posix_fadvise there was plain old fadvise so  
it's portable to older platforms too whereas async I/o isn't.


Posix_fadvise does require two syscalls and two trips to the buffer  
manager. But that doesn't really make it a kludge if the resulting  
code is cleaner than the async I/o code would be. To use async I/o we  
would have to pin all the buffers we're reading which would be quite a  
lot of code changes.
